内容大纲: 1. 介绍Web3的概念和背景 2. Web3的特点和优势 3. Web3的应用领域 4. Web3如何实现去中心化? 5. Web3与传统Web的区别是什么? 6. Web3对用户数据隐私的保护如何? 7. Web3的发展前景和挑战是什么? 总字数:3000字以上 正文内容:

1. 介绍Web3的概念和背景

Web3是指下一代互联网技术的发展方向,它旨在构建一个去中心化、用户更具掌控权的网络环境。传统的Web2时代,用户对自己的个人数据和隐私权的控制相对较少,大部分由中心化的服务提供商掌控。而Web3则通过区块链技术和智能合约等手段,使用户能够更好地掌控自己的数据和数字资产。

2. Web3的特点和优势

Web3的特点主要包括去中心化、可编程性、安全性和开放性。

去中心化是Web3的核心特点之一,通过区块链技术,数据和应用不再集中存储在某个中心化的服务器上,而是分布式存储在网络的各个节点上,实现了数据的去中心化管理。

可编程性是Web3的另一个重要特点,通过区块链技术中的智能合约,用户可以编写自己的业务逻辑和规则,实现更多样化的应用场景。

安全性是Web3相较于传统Web的一大优势,区块链技术的去中心化和加密特性使得数据更加安全可信,难以被篡改。

开放性是Web3的另一重要特点,任何人都可以参与其中,通过共识机制来实现网络的管理和维护,开放、透明的网络环境有利于促进创新和合作。

3. Web3的应用领域

Web3的应用领域十分广泛,涵盖了金融、物联网、社交媒体、游戏等多个领域。

在金融领域,Web3的去中心化特性使得传统的中介机构可以被替代,实现直接点对点的交易和资金管理。

在物联网领域,Web3可以提供更加安全可信的设备和数据交换,实现设备之间的直接通信和智能合约管理。

在社交媒体领域,Web3可以让用户对自己的数据和隐私有更多掌控权,减少中心化平台的垄断。

在游戏领域,Web3可以实现虚拟经济的可拓展性和可交易性,用户可以真正拥有自己在游戏中的数字资产。

4. Web3如何实现去中心化?

Web3实现去中心化主要依靠区块链技术,区块链是一个基于共识的分布式账本,通过去中心化的节点共同管理和维护数据。

区块链通过共识机制来保证数据的一致性和可信度,常见的共识机制有工作量证明(Proof of Work)和权益证明(Proof of Stake)。

在区块链上,数据以区块的形式存在,每个新的区块通过哈希算法与前一个区块相连,形成一个不可篡改的链条。每个区块都包含了交易记录和前一个区块的哈希值,确保了数据的安全性和完整性。

智能合约也是实现Web3去中心化的重要手段,智能合约是一段可执行的代码,可以在区块链上执行和存储。通过智能合约,用户可以自定义规则和逻辑,实现不同应用场景的去中心化管理。

总的来说,Web3通过区块链技术和智能合约的应用,实现了去中心化的网络环境。

5. Web3与传统Web的区别是什么?

Web3与传统Web(Web2)相比,有以下几个主要区别:

首先,Web3是去中心化的,而传统Web是中心化的。在传统Web中,用户的数据和服务主要由中心化的平台提供商掌控,用户无法完全掌控自己的数据和资产。而Web3则通过区块链和智能合约,实现了数据和资产的去中心化管理,用户能够更好地掌控自己的数据。

其次,Web3具有更高的安全性。传统Web中,因为数据集中存储在中心化的服务器上,一旦服务器被攻击或数据被篡改,用户的数据就面临严重的安全风险。而Web3通过区块链的去中心化和加密算法的应用,使得数据更加安全可信,难以被篡改。

另外,Web3具有更高的开放性和可编程性。传统Web中,平台和应用的开发者需要依赖中心化的平台提供商,受到平台的限制和控制。而Web3则通过智能合约的应用,使得开发者可以自定义业务逻辑和规则,实现更多样化的应用场景,具有更高的开放性和可编程性。

6. Web3对用户数据隐私的保护如何?

Web3对用户数据隐私的保护主要通过区块链技术和加密算法实现。

首先,Web3的去中心化特性使得用户的数据不再集中存储在某个中心化的服务器上,而是分布式存储在网络的各个节点上。这意味着用户的数据不再易受单点攻击,提高了数据的安全性。

其次,区块链中的数据是通过加密算法进行加密存储的,只有持有相应私钥的用户才能访问和操作自己的数据。区块链中的交易和数据都是公开透明的,但用户的身份和隐私信息是通过加密保护的,提高了用户数据的隐私保护。

此外,Web3中的智能合约可以实现数据的权限控制和访问控制,用户可以对自己的数据设置访问权限,并自定义数据的访问规则,进一步保护数据隐私。

7. Web3的发展前景和挑战是什么?

Web3具有巨大的发展前景,但也面临一些挑战。

Web3的发展前景主要体现在以下几个方面:

首先,Web3有望改变传统互联网的商业模式,通过去中心化和智能合约的应用,实现更多样化的商业模式和价值创造方式。

其次,Web3有望推动数字经济的发展,通过区块链和智能合约的技术,实现数字资产的可交易性和可拓展性。

另外,Web3有望改变现有的社交和媒体格局,通过去中心化的社交媒体平台,用户可以更好地掌控自己的数据和隐私,减少平台的垄断。

然而,Web3的发展也面临一些挑战:

首先,技术标准和互操作性的问题。目前Web3的技术标准还没有完全统一,不同的区块链平台和智能合约系统之间的互操作性仍然存在一定的难度。

其次,用户体验和普及度的问题。目前大部分Web3应用还存在一定的技术门槛和用户体验问题,需要进一步提高普及度和用户友好性。

另外,监管和法律问题也是Web3发展的一大挑战,如何在保护用户权益的同时,合理规范和监管Web3应用成为亟待解决的问题。